Roof covering Evaluation



Consistently checking your roofing system is critical to guaranteeing it can stand up to the extreme wintertime climate in advance. Start by checking for any kind of missing, damaged, or crinkling roof shingles. These might bring about leakages or further damages during wintertime storms. Watch out for any type of indicators of water damage or mold, as these could suggest a larger problem with your roof's honesty. Examine the flashing around chimneys, vents, and skylights to ensure they're protected and watertight.


It's likewise crucial to inspect the rain gutters and downspouts for debris or clogs that can create water to back up and possibly harm your roofing system.

Throughout your evaluation, pay attention to any kind of locations where water could pool or build up, as this might compromise the roofing system's structure in time. Search for any type of indications of drooping or dips in the roofline, as these might suggest underlying problems that require to be attended to before winter months sets in.

Debris Removal



When it pertains to preparing your roofing system for wintertime, one necessary task is removing debris that can create prospective issues. Beginning by getting rid of fallen leaves, branches, and any other particles that has actually collected on your roofing system. These products can trap wetness, producing a breeding ground for mold and mildew, which can damage your roof over time. Utilize a strong ladder to access your roof covering safely, and a broom or fallen leave blower to sweep off the particles.

Pay special attention to the valleys and rain gutters where particles has a tendency to build up one of the most.
